CougFan.com: Washington State and the Pac-12 schools stood to earn $276.4 million in media rights fees from ESPN and Fox in the 2020-21 college sports cycle, The Mercury News reports. Included in that is $23 million per school – 80 percent of the total — for 45 football games. But with the fall season cancelled, will the Pac-12 still get paid all of it, some of it, or none of it?
That’s a complex question.
